Rascal Flatts lead singer Gary LeVox might want to move closer to a cell phone tower. The singer tells Chicago radio station US 99 that his group was invited by Oprah Winfrey to perform at the kick-off party for the 24th season of her TV show, but he almost missed her phone call!

"I was actually out at my ranch, and I don't have any service there," Gary told US99 in a call from the green room at the TV icon's Harpo Studios. "I thought, 'I'm just gonna head back home.' Soon as I got back in range my phone was like 'ding ding ding ding ding' ... I was actually hanging tree stands!"

Performing along with the Black Eyed Peas, James Taylor, Jennifer Hudson, and Criss Angel, Gary notes that it's always exciting to share the stage with other artists. "It took ten years doing this stuff, you've run into most of these cats a bunch of times through the years, so it's cool when you get a bunch of us on the same show from different genres doing different stuff."

And of the host herself, Gary says simply, "She's a sweetheart, man."

In July, Rascal Flatts became the first country act to perform at Chicago's legendary Wrigley Field. "It's so good to be back in this city we love so much," Gary gushed.

Rascal Flatts will perform Oprah's personal request, 'Life Is a Highway,' as well as their recent hit single, 'Summer Nights' on 'The Oprah Winfrey Show' season 24 kick-off party this Thursday (Sept. 10).
